I understand your concern about metal tips (brass, chrome, anodized aluminum, etc), but stainless steel should be ok. Other than metal, you have acrylic, ceramic, Delrin (plastic), Tru Stone, and glass. Here is a short-list of drip tip vendors I've looked at.

Empire Mods and High Desert Vapes have a decent selection of 'mainstream' drip tips covering a wide range of materials.

Sagewood Glass makes custom/unique glass tips, but are expensive.

Alice in Vapeland has some nice reasonably-priced 3D 'girly' tips, but most are out of stock.

Bull Box Mods does a rather small, but unique, selection of hand-made tips from acrylic and tru stone.

Molehill Mountain Art specializes in hand-made wood tips.

A lot of these will do custom work, but by and large, if you want unique, you are going to pay for it. The best advice I can give you is to look around, see what's out there, figure out what you like. Google is your friend. ;)

Drip tips are simply nicely shaped tubes. Why not make your own?
If you, or someone you know, works with acrylic or the various synthetic hobby clays, it is a fairly simple project. If you know someone who uses a lathe for wood turning, even better.
Here is one I did some time ago. http://www.e-cigarette-forum.com/forum/canada-forum/349788-whacha-think-these-3.html
It's made of Corian, a synthetic kitchen counter top material. Since then, I have turned dozens from acrylic, wood and other materials. It's actually a fun little skill builder project for wood turning.
